Rickshaw Stop

Welcome to Rickshaw Stop in San Francisco, a vibrant music venue and dance club that sets the stage for unforgettable nights filled with live music and energetic vibes. Located at 155 Fell St, this hipster hotspot is a favorite among locals and visitors alike.

Step inside Rickshaw Stop and you'll be greeted with a casual and lively atmosphere perfect for groups looking to dance the night away. With a roaring DJ, live music performances, and happy hour specials, Thursdays, Fridays, and Saturdays are the best nights to experience the excitement here.

Customer reviews rave about the quality of music at Rickshaw Stop, with one reviewer calling it "probably the best music venue in SF for up and coming local and international artists." Others praise the small and intimate environment, easy parking, and friendly staff.

The venue features gender-neutral restrooms, outdoor seating, and a tiered balcony for a unique viewing experience of the artists. The acoustics and sound system are top-notch, ensuring a memorable musical experience for all attendees.
